CeFeO₃ (cerium iron oxide) is a perovskite-structured ceramic compound combining rare-earth cerium with iron in a 1:1 stoichiometry. This material is primarily investigated in research contexts for its mixed-valence electronic properties and potential catalytic activity, rather than as an established commercial engineering material. The cerium-iron oxide system is of interest in heterogeneous catalysis, energy conversion, and solid-state chemistry applications where the variable oxidation states of both cations enable redox reactions and oxygen mobility.
